Hearing it was for Iris, Georgia was about to refuse, but the thought of the ever-graceful Colin made her reluctantly reach out and take it.
No sooner had Georgia placed the two servings of croissant sandwiches on the seat where Meridith had been sitting than her phone rang again. Seeing it was Lila calling, Georgia set down the croissant sandwich and stepped out of the exhibition hall.
"Georgia, be honest with me. Was that bitch Caroline deliberately trying to sabotage you? Otherwise, how could your perfect formula get zero bids?"
Georgia was stunned.
Back in the hall, the moment Georgia stepped out to take her call, Alicia's eyes glinted with malice as she fixed her gaze on Georgia's croissant sandwich.
After an eternity of inner struggle, Alicia quickly composed herself. Feigning nonchalance, she walked over to where the croissant sandwich was placed. After furtively scanning her surroundings and confirming that no one was watching, she swiftly pulled out a packet of white powder, emptied it into the food, and then quickly melted away.
After quickly reassuring Lila, Georgia returned to her seat, finished her own croissant sandwich in a few bites, then picked up Iris's portion and brought it over to her.
Seeing Georgia had brought her the croissant sandwich, Iris froze for a moment. It wasn't until Georgia pressed the croissant sandwich into her hands that she snapped out of it.
"Th... thank you..."
She hadn't expected this pampered young girl to have such a considerate side. Georgia gave a faint smile and said, "You're welcome!"
As Georgia turned to leave, she suddenly heard Iris abruptly thrust up her bidding paddle and shout.
"One million dollars!"
"One million?"
"One million dollars?"
"Someone just bid three million dollars—straight up!"
The host, clearly astonished by the amount on Miss Crawford's bidding paddle, maintained the auction proceedings while subtly watching Caroline for cues.
Nobody expected this. Just when the auction seemed finished, it suddenly changed in a surprising way.
Seeing the crowd's astonished reactions, Iris took a triumphant sip of her tea and beamed with pride, showing off to Colin.
"See? I'm not being petty at all... "
Before she could finish, her face suddenly drained of color. Clutching her stomach in agony, she collapsed to the floor with a heavy thud.
Colin was horrified, immediately scooping his sister into his arms and yelling, "Ambulance! Someone, call an ambulance now!"
The crowd was still reeling from the shock of the sky-high bid when Colin's desperate shout shattered the silence. Instantly, chaos erupted throughout the hall.
The entire hall was plunged into pandemonium. Caroline and Simon rushed forward, their faces instantly drained of color. They had always feared offending the powerful Crawford family, and now that the Crawford heiress had collapsed at their auction, the couple frantically paced about like ants on a hot griddle.
At the sight, Alicia's face turned even more deathly pale.
She clearly put the poison in Georgia's croissant sandwich. But Georgia perfectly fine, and it's Iris who had been poisoned.
The Crawford family wasn't someone she could afford to provoke. The more she thought about it, the colder her heart grew.
'What should I do?' she thought.
Fighting off dizziness, Alicia frantically hid behind the crowd. After all, no one saw her poison Georgia's croissant sandwich. They couldn't trace it back to her.
Georgia delivered the croissant sandwich. Even if anyone had suspicions, she would be the prime suspect.
Alicia kept reassuring herself.
Colin scooped up his sister and rushed her into the waiting ambulance, with Caroline and Simon hastily following them to the hospital.
After they left, the scene was still in chaos. But soon, the Crawford family stormed in, flanked by a squad of police officers.
Though in his fifties, Alfred's chiseled features were still striking. Dressed in an immaculate military uniform, he radiated calm determination and a commanding presence—the kind honed by years of giving orders.
Alfred thundered, "Nobody moves! My daughter came here solely to bid on a special-effect drug. So how the hell did she end up poisoned and hospitalized?"
